Add 48/8 and 90/45
1st number: 6 0/8, 2nd number: 2 0/45
48/8 + 90/45 is 8/1.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 8 and 45 is 360
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 360 - For the 1st fraction, since 8 × 45 = 360,
48/8 = 48 × 45/8 × 45 = 2160/360 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 45 × 8 = 360,
90/45 = 90 × 8/45 × 8 = 720/360 - Add the two like fractions:
2160/360 + 720/360 = 2160 + 720/360 = 2880/360 - 2880/360 simplified gives 8/1
- So, 48/8 + 90/45 = 8/1
